EDITORS COMMENTS
This photograph showcases the Klemm Kl 35 (G-KLEM / D-EFTG), a classic transport aircraft that once graced the skies with its distinctive design. The Klemm Kl 35, manufactured by the German company Klemm Flugzeugbau, was a versatile and popular aircraft during the interwar period and into the early years of World War II. The aircraft in this image, registered as both G-KLEM in the United Kingdom and D-EFTG in Germany, is seen here in flight, its wings outstretched and propellers turning at full throttle. The Klemm Kl 35 was known for its open cockpit, which offered a thrilling flying experience for pilots, and its ability to carry a variety of payloads, making it a favorite among private owners and small aviation companies. The Klemm Kl 35 was designed by the renowned German aircraft engineer Anton Klemm and first flew in 1933. It was a single-engine, low-wing monoplane with a cruciform tail and fixed landing gear. The aircraft's sleek design and robust construction made it a favorite among pilots and aviation enthusiasts, and it saw use in various roles, including transport, training, and even light reconnaissance.
